Snapchat now offers temporary custom geofilters, starting at $5

When you're taking a picture with Snapchat, there are a few different overlays that you can pick from. These include the time, your speed, and the current temperature. And depending on your location, you might find a unique geofilter. Soon, you'll be able to create your own temporary geofilter, for a price.

Last year, the company started offering custom geofilters to large companies. They could pay a large sum of money for a custom badge that will show up for people taking snaps in their area. While this was a nice way to add some extra revanue for the company, the geofilters were rather expensive. But now they're looking to offer inexpensive, temporary ones, that anyone can submit.

Let's say you're hosting an event, and all of your hip friends that use Snapchat will be coming. You can design a unique badge that they can add to all of their snaps for the night. You'll need to design the badge, then setup a specific time and a geofence for it. This means setting a specific area where the geofilter will work. Ideally, you'd just fence off the location of the event, with a little bit of a buffer.

Once you've got everything setup, you'll need to send it off to Snapchat for review. They'll get back to you in one business day, and let you know how much the charge will be. The geofilters will start at $5, but can increase in price depending on the size of the area you want it to cover, and how long you want to make it available.
